The HR Generalist/Admin plays a pivotal role in HR operations ensuring seamless processes that align with our organizational goals. We're looking for someone with 1-3 years of administrative experience to join our team! We embrace a hybrid work model, with 3 days of onsite collaboration weekly.

  • Provide comprehensive support in managing employee records within the HRIS, ensuring compliance with legal and company guidelines.
  • Collaborate in the implementation and communication of HR policies and procedures.
  • Support the organization's adherence to federal, state, and local employment laws, assisting with the preparation of documentation for audits and inspections.
  • Assist in generating HR reports and maintaining key metrics (e.g., workforce plans, turnover, recruitment timelines) to provide foundational data for leadership insights.
  • Work collaboratively to support the recruitment process, including intern program coordination, interview scheduling, and maintaining required compliance documentation (Circa, AAP).
  • Assist the payroll function by ensuring accurate documentation of employee changes.
  • Provide support to employees regarding benefits enrollment and inquiries related to healthcare, retirement plans, and wellness programs.
  • Collaborate in the administration of employee engagement programs, such as recognition initiatives and development opportunities.
  • Coordinate employee surveys and assist in the analysis of results to support improvement of workplace culture.
  • Organize training sessions under the guidance of the HR Business Partner.
  • Assist in the management, optimization and maintenance of HR systems, ensuring data accuracy and user accessibility.
  • Contribute to the identification of opportunities for streamlining HR processes and implement efficiency-driven solutions.
  • Undertake other duties as needed to support the HR team objectives.
  • Solid understanding of fundamental HR best practices & operations.
  • Working knowledge of HR software/systems (HRIS, ATS) for process application.
  • Proficient in MS Office Suite (Outlook, Excel, Word, PowerPoint) for communication & basic data management.
  • Strong organizational & time-management skills; detail-oriented.
  • Excellent interpersonal & communication skills; collaborative & supportive.
  • Demonstrated ability to handle sensitive info with confidentiality & professionalism in a team.
  • Positive, collaborative mindset; willing to contribute to process improvements.
  • 1-2 years' experience assisting with HRA administration.
  • Familiarity with the principles of wellness and employee engagement programs.
  • Experience working in a healthcare, regulated environment preferred.
